以太坊(Ethereum)是一个去中心化的区块链平台,以其智能合约功能而闻名。用户可以在以太坊网络上创建和管理钱包地址。随着数字货币的日益普及,越来越多的人希望了解如何利用以太坊连接来查询钱包地址。本文将详细介绍如何通过以太坊连接查询钱包地址的各个方面,并解答一些相关问题,帮助用户更好地理解这一过程。

一、以太坊钱包地址的基础知识

在深入了解如何查询以太坊钱包地址之前,我们需要弄清楚什么是以太坊钱包地址。以太坊钱包地址是一个类似于银行账户的数字标识符,用于接收和发送以太坊(ETH)和基于以太坊的代币(如ERC20、ERC721等)。以太坊钱包地址通常由42个字符构成,以“0x”开头,后面跟随40个十六进制字符。

对于用户而言,钱包地址非常重要,因为它是与区块链交互的唯一凭证。用户可以通过钱包地址查看交易记录、余额和其他信息。所需查询的信息包括但不限于交易次数、所持有的代币及其数量等。

二、如何查询以太坊钱包地址

查询以太坊钱包地址并不复杂,用户可以通过多种方式获得所需信息。最常用的方法包括使用区块链浏览器、以太坊节点或开发者工具。以下是详细的步骤:

1. 使用区块链浏览器

区块链浏览器是查找以太坊钱包信息的最简单方法。以太坊的热门区块链浏览器包括Etherscan、Etherchain以及Blockchair等。这些浏览器提供了用户友好的界面,使得查询过程变得轻松愉快。步骤如下:

  • 打开区块链浏览器(例如Etherscan);
  • 在搜索框中输入以太坊钱包地址;
  • 点击搜索按钮;
  • 查看钱包地址的信息,包括余额、交易记录等详细信息。

2. 使用以太坊节点

对于开发者或技术用户,他们可能更倾向于使用以太坊节点来查询钱包地址。通过运行自己的以太坊节点,用户可以直接访问以太坊网络,这样可以在高度控制的环境中查询信息。首先,需要设置一个以太坊节点并同步网络数据,然后使用命令行工具进行查询。具体步骤如下:

  • 确保您的计算机上已安装Go-Ethereum(Geth)或Parity等客户端;
  • 运行节点并等待其与以太坊网络同步;
  • 在命令行中使用web3.js库或RPC接口进行查询;
  • 获取钱包地址的详细信息。

3. 使用开发者工具

如果你是开发者,也可以通过编程语言(如JavaScript、Python等)调用以太坊的API查询钱包信息。这种方法灵活性强,适合需要批量处理或集成到其他系统中的应用。简单示例:


const Web3 = require('web3');
const web3 = new Web3('https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ID');

async function getWalletInfo(address) {
    const balance = await web3.eth.getBalance(address);
    console.log(`钱包地址: ${address}, 余额: ${web3.utils.fromWei(balance, 'ether')} ETH`);
}
getWalletInfo('钱包地址');

三、查询以太坊钱包地址时的注意事项

在查询以太坊钱包地址时,有一些注意事项需要牢记:

  • 确保输入正确的地址,任何符号或字符的错误都可能导致查询失败;
  • 注意网络拥堵情况,特别是在高峰时间段,可能会影响查询的速度;
  • 了解隐私问题,一些信息可能隐含在链上,查询时需考虑数据安全。

四、关于以太坊的常见问题

1. 如何保护我的以太坊钱包地址?

保护以太坊钱包地址的安全至关重要,因为被他人获知后,可能会导致资产损失。以下是一些保护措施:

  • 使用强密码:确保钱包的密码复杂且不容易被猜测,最好使用密码管理工具生成并存储密码。
  • 启用双重验证:许多钱包服务提供双重验证功能,增加额外的保护层。
  • 定期备份钱包:备份钱包文件,并安全存储在离线设备中,避免数据丢失。
  • 警惕钓鱼攻击:避免点击可疑链接或下载不明软件,以防止个人信息被盗。

2. 我可以使用一个钱包地址进行多次交易吗?

是的,您可以使用一个以太坊钱包地址进行多次交易。以太坊网络的设计允许用户通过同一地址进行多次交易,这使得用户可以方便地管理所有资金和代币。不过,需注意以下几点:

  • 每次交易会改变余额,因此建议定期检查钱包地址的状态;
  • 为了隐私考量,特别是在大额交易时,许多用户选择生成多个地址进行不同目的的交易;
  • 使用同一地址交易时,公众可以随时查看到所有交易记录,保持透明性。

3. 如何看以太坊钱包的余额?

查看以太坊钱包余额是非常简单的,用户只需几个步骤。不论是使用区块链浏览器还是以太坊节点,操作基本一致。具体步骤为:

  • 访问Etherscan等区块链浏览器;
  • 在搜索框中输入你的以太坊钱包地址;
  • 点击搜索,页面会显示该地址的余额、交易记录等信息。

为了确保余额的准确性,建议多次查询并与其他服务(如手机App)对比,确保无误。

4. 查询钱包地址需要支付费用吗?

查询以太坊钱包地址通常是不需要支付费用的。用户通过区块链浏览器查看自己或他人的地址信息时,都是免费的。然而,如果您希望使用 API 查询或者在自己的应用中集成查询功能,可能会遇到服务收费的情况。例如,Infura等服务如果超过免费使用额度,需要按量付费。

5. 有没有工具可以自动化查询以太坊钱包地址信息?

是的,目前市面上有多种工具和服务可以帮助用户自动化查询以太坊钱包地址信息。我们可以利用脚本、API接口甚至是现有的开源项目来实现自动化。例如,通过结合Node.js和web3.js,开发者可以快速创建查询工具,定时获取特定钱包地址的状态。有很多开源代码可以作为参考,使得整个过程高效而便捷。

总之,查询以太坊钱包地址是一件相对简单的事情,但要注意安全和隐私。随着技术的发展,查询方式也在不断进步,希望此次的介绍能够帮助到广大用户,让您在以太坊的使用过程中更加得心应手。